Today is DISNEY CRUISE Day!!!!! Woo Hoo!! 4 years of planning and now it was time to enjoy it!! We got all our stuff packed up (AGAIN) and we were headed out to the port. We left around 9:00 am for our wet and rainy drive to the port.

I took a few pictures of the Magic as we came over the bridge, but it was raining so I don’t know how they will come out.

As usual, getting into the port area is a breeze. They have people everywhere telling you what  you need and where to go. We showed our ID’s, went and dropped off our luggage..we needed one more luggage tag and it was NO problem, they were able to print one out for us right there. (this was for our Fish Extender Gift bags.) We waited in line for a few minutes to pay for parking and then to park. It was still raining, so we hurried up and went and got in line for the security check.

We got through security pretty quickly, and rode the escalators up to check in!! They did have us fill out a health form to see if anyone had been sick or not. We didn’t even have to wait to check in! The check in was a breeze as well. We showed our passports (and had to sign them, we forgot to do so before). We got boarding pass #8. I just showed the credit card we were putting down on the account, and then she handed us our Castaway Cay Club lanyards and map and told us to have a great cruise! (Castaway Cay Club members are anyone who has sailed on the Disney Cruise before.)

We then had to go get our picture taken for security. This also went very quickly. The adults had to show photo Id’s (we used our passports).  Then it was off to get our pictures taken with Captain Mickey!!
